Funcom Productions A/S (OSE: FUNCOM) is a Norwegian video game developer specializing in online games. It is best known for the massively multiplayer online role-playing game (MMORPG) titles Age of Conan, Anarchy Online, and its The Longest Journey series of adventure games. In addition to their Oslo headquarters, Funcom has offices in the United States, China, Switzerland, and Canada. Founded in 1993 by Erik Gloersen, Ian Neil, Andre Backen, Gaute Godager and Olav Mørkrid, the company is one of the leading European independent game developers and publishers. They focus mainly on PC games but have also released games on other consoles such as Sega Mega Drive/Genesis, Super NES, Sega Saturn and Xbox. In December 2005, Funcom was the first Norwegian game developer to be listed on the Oslo Stock Exchange.
